Other Things to Note Beulah is a beautiful mountain town with a small post office, gas station, food market, food truck, and mountain park perfect for hiking.
We are located only 20 miles from Pueblo, within driving distance of several 14ers, 40 mins from San Isabel, 30 minutes to Lake Pueblo, 1.5 hours to the Royal Gorge in Canon City, and 1 hour from Colorado Springs airport.
Beulah is a getaway on its own but also serves as the perfect stopping point for some amazing Colorado exploration opportunities!

About the area
Beulah
Located in Beulah, this holiday home is in the mountains and on the waterfront. Bishop Castle is a local landmark,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Pueblo Mountain Park and Rudolph Mountain Trailhead. Kayaking and rafting offer great chances to get out on the surrounding water, or you can seek out an adventure with mountain biking and rock climbing nearby.
